I personally prefer to go out and "Google" the different models and read the reviews. I also look to make sure that the machine(s) in question meet the spec standards I'm looking for. Definitely shop around and consider mail order. You might even be able to start a price war between competitors, make them bid for your purchase. Key thing is to make sure you get what you want, don't settle for what's available on the shelf. |
